Longevity and Technology: Innovations Transforming Senior Living

Technological advancements are revolutionizing senior care, significantly impacting the quality of life for older adults. This article examines key innovations designed to foster safety, independence, and well-being in later life, analyzing their application through established theoretical frameworks. Key concepts explored include ubiquitous computing, assistive technology, remote patient monitoring, telemedicine, the social determinants of health, neuroplasticity, cognitive rehabilitation, human-computer interaction, human-robot interaction, precision medicine, and person-centered care. These concepts are fundamental to understanding the effectiveness and ethical implications of the technologies discussed.

Enhancing Safety and Independence through Smart Home Technologies

Smart home technologies substantially improve the safety and convenience of senior living. Ubiquitous computing facilitates seamless device integration, creating personalized, responsive environments. Voice-activated assistants (e.g., Amazon Alexa, Google Home) exemplify this, providing hands-free control of lighting, appliances, and communication, enhancing accessibility for individuals with mobility limitations. Automated systems, leveraging automation and control theory principles, manage medication reminders and thermostat adjustments, creating safer, more comfortable living. This aligns with the assistive technology model, promoting self-sufficiency and reducing caregiver reliance for daily tasks. The impact on residents’ independence is demonstrably positive, measurable through reduced dependence on external assistance.

Assistive Technologies: Empowering Independent Living

Assistive technologies address age-related challenges, supporting independent living. Advanced hearing aids exemplify sensory augmentation principles, while electric wheelchairs and mobility scooters enhance mobility and autonomy. Their design adheres to human-computer interaction principles, prioritizing usability for older adults. These tools enable active lifestyles and community participation, reducing reliance on external assistance and fostering self-efficacy. The successful integration of these technologies requires careful consideration of user needs and preferences during design and implementation.

Continuous Health Monitoring and Emergency Response via Wearable Technology

Wearable technology (smartwatches, fitness trackers) enables continuous health monitoring, employing remote patient monitoring principles. These devices track vital signs (heart rate, activity levels, sleep patterns), providing valuable data for individuals and healthcare providers. Fall detection and emergency SOS features enhance safety and reduce anxiety. This proactive health management aligns with preventative healthcare principles, empowering individuals to actively participate in their well-being. Early detection of health deterioration enables timely intervention, a crucial principle in geriatric care management.

Telehealth: Bridging Geographical Barriers and Expanding Healthcare Access

Telehealth services, leveraging telecommunication technology, overcome geographical healthcare access barriers, particularly relevant for rural seniors and those with limited mobility. Video conferencing enables remote consultations, reducing travel and inconvenience. Telemedicine principles ensure consultation quality and efficacy while improving accessibility and affordability. This aligns with universal healthcare access principles and is especially relevant given an aging population and rising healthcare costs. Effective integration of telehealth into existing healthcare systems enhances efficiency and effectiveness. The success of telehealth implementation hinges on robust infrastructure, reliable technology, and adequate training for both patients and healthcare providers.

Cognitive Training and Mental Stimulation through Technology

While cognitive decline is a natural part of aging, technology can mitigate its effects. Cognitive training apps apply neuroplasticity and cognitive rehabilitation principles, offering engaging brain exercises to improve memory, attention, and problem-solving. The gamified nature of many apps enhances engagement and adherence. Regular use promotes cognitive reserve, contributing to a more fulfilling and mentally active lifestyle and potentially delaying cognitive decline. The design of these apps needs to consider the specific cognitive abilities and needs of the target user population to maximize effectiveness and engagement.

Social Connection and Mental Well-being through Digital Communication

Combating social isolation is crucial. Social media and communication apps facilitate communication regardless of distance, addressing social determinants of health. Strong social connections are vital for mental and emotional well-being. These technologies mitigate the negative impacts of social isolation, a significant risk factor for various health problems. From a social psychology perspective, they reinforce social identity and belonging, improving quality of life. However, the digital divide and unequal access to technology must be addressed to ensure equitable benefits for all senior citizens.

Remote Monitoring Systems: Enhanced Safety and Caregiver Support

Remote monitoring systems provide valuable caregiver support, using sensor technology and data analytics to track activity levels, medication adherence, and routine changes. This aligns with remote health monitoring principles, providing early warnings of potential health problems. Timely interventions reduce caregiver burden and improve both the senior’s safety and caregiver’s quality of life. Reduced stress and improved well-being for both the patient and family are key benefits. The ethical considerations regarding data privacy and the potential for surveillance need careful attention when deploying these systems.

Robotic Companionship: Addressing Social Isolation

Robotic companions (Paro, Pepper) offer companionship and emotional support, particularly beneficial for those experiencing loneliness. While not replacing human interaction, they provide engaging interaction and reduce isolation. Their application draws upon therapeutic robotics principles to improve mental health outcomes. The design considers human-robot interaction principles, ensuring intuitive and safe usage. The acceptance and effectiveness of robotic companions depend on careful consideration of user preferences, cultural factors, and the overall integration within a holistic care plan.

Virtual Reality: Expanding Life Experiences

Virtual reality (VR) expands seniors’ horizons, offering immersive experiences without physical limitations. VR can be used for exploration, social interaction, cognitive stimulation, and reducing confinement. Its application aligns with entertainment therapy principles to improve mental stimulation and emotional well-being. The potential of VR in senior care is vast, but further research is needed to explore its effectiveness for various cognitive and emotional conditions.

Medication Management and Online Services: Simplifying Daily Tasks

Medication management apps simplify complex schedules, reducing errors and improving adherence. Online shopping and delivery services enhance convenience and safety. These leverage human-factors engineering principles to make daily tasks simpler and less error-prone. The usability and accessibility of these services are crucial for their successful adoption by older adults with varying levels of technological literacy.

Emergency Response and Enhanced Security Systems: Prioritizing Safety

Personal emergency response systems (PERS) and smart home security systems provide immediate access to help and enhance safety. These systems leverage risk management and emergency response principles for rapid assistance in emergencies. A comprehensive safety plan integrating these systems offers essential protection and promotes independent living with reduced risks. The reliability and responsiveness of these systems are paramount to ensure their effectiveness in critical situations.

Artificial Intelligence: Transforming Healthcare Delivery

Artificial intelligence (AI) transforms healthcare through data analysis and predictive modeling. AI-powered systems analyze medical data, predict potential health problems, and provide personalized treatment recommendations. This application of AI adheres to precision medicine principles to improve diagnostic accuracy and optimize treatment plans. The ethical and societal implications of using AI in healthcare, including data privacy, algorithmic bias, and potential job displacement, require careful consideration.

Technology Supporting Dementia Care

Technology plays a crucial role in dementia care, addressing challenges such as wandering and cognitive decline. GPS trackers and location sensors enhance safety, while interactive memory aids and reminiscence therapy apps provide cognitive stimulation and support memory recall. These technologies align with person-centered care principles, improving the quality of life for individuals with dementia and their caregivers. The design and implementation of these technologies need to consider the unique needs and challenges of individuals living with dementia and their families.

Conclusions and Recommendations

Technological innovations significantly enhance the quality of life for seniors, promoting safety, independence, and well-being. These advancements address age-related challenges, improve healthcare access, and combat social isolation. Future research should prioritize ethical considerations, particularly regarding data privacy, algorithmic bias, and equitable access. User-friendly interfaces tailored to the needs of older adults are crucial. Long-term effects on cognitive function, social engagement, and overall health outcomes should be investigated. Collaborative efforts between technology developers, healthcare professionals, and policymakers are essential for successful integration into healthcare systems and senior living communities to maximize the positive impact on the lives of older adults. Furthermore, a comprehensive evaluation framework is needed to assess the effectiveness and cost-benefit of these technologies in diverse senior populations and care settings.
